What Matters Most

Tile work is the biggest variable in bathroom remodel costs. A basic ceramic tile shower runs $1,500-3,000 installed; a custom tile shower with niche and bench can hit $5,000-10,000.

Pro Tip

Invest in a quality shower pan and waterproofing membrane — they're invisible but prevent the kind of water damage that turns a $10K remodel into a $25K gut job.

Common Mistake

Choosing trendy tile that's difficult to source replacements for. When a tile cracks in five years, a discontinued line means retiling the whole wall.

Best Time to Buy

January and February are the slowest months for bathroom remodelers. You'll get more attention, faster scheduling, and sometimes better pricing.

Bathroom Remodel Cost Breakdown in Greeley

Bathroom Remodel Cost Items — Greeley

Adjusted for Greeley
16 cost items — hover rows for details
ItemLow Est.High Est.Note
Bathtub / shower (prefab)
$698$2,326
Custom tile shower
$2,908$8,141labor-intensive
Walk-in shower conversion
$3,489$9,304
Vanity & sink
$465$2,908
Toilet (standard)
$233$698
Toilet (smart/bidet)
$582$2,908growing trend
Floor tile
$582$2,326
Wall tile / wainscoting
$465$2,093
Faucets & fixtures (chrome)
$233$698
Faucets & fixtures (brushed gold)
$465$1,396designer finish
Mirror & medicine cabinet
$174$698
Ventilation fan
$116$407
Plumbing labor
$698$2,326
Electrical (lighting & fan)
$349$1,163
Waterproofing & backer board
$233$698
Demolition & disposal
$465$1,396

Before You Spend: Checklist

  • Never pay more than 10-15% upfront; structure payments by milestone
  • Check Better Business Bureau rating and online reviews (Google, Yelp, Angi)
  • Ask for references from recent local jobs — call them
  • Get a detailed written scope of work before signing anything
  • Confirm the quote reflects Greeley-area labor rates, not a generic estimate
  • Get a firm timeline with start date, milestones, and completion date

Hidden Costs of Bathroom Remodel in Greeley That Most People Miss

One of the most overlooked costs in Greeley's home services market is permit fees. Depending on the scope of your bathroom remodel project, city and county permits can add $233 to $930 to your total bill. Many homeowners budget only for the contractor's quote and are surprised when permit costs, inspection fees, and required code upgrades inflate the final number by 10-20%.

Another hidden expense is the cost of temporary fixes or emergency work while waiting for your scheduled project. In Greeley, where demand keeps contractors booked 3-6 weeks out, homeowners often pay premium rates for interim repairs. Additionally, disposal fees for old materials (especially for bathroom remodel) can run $174 to $582 — a cost many contractors exclude from initial quotes.

Finally, consider the opportunity cost. During major bathroom remodel work, you may face temporary displacement, lost workdays if you work from home, increased utility usage from open walls or exposed systems, and potential damage to adjacent areas that requires additional repair.
